比特币钱包安全架构:全面解析保护数字资产的
引言
随着加密货币的日益普及,比特币作为其中最为知名和重要的数字货币,吸引了大量投资者和用户的关注。而比特币钱包,作为用户存储、接收和发送比特币的工具,其安全性自然成为了一个热点话题。在数字资产日益增长的今天,如何设计一个安全的比特币钱包架构以确保用户的资金安全,不仅是开发者的责任,也是用户必须关注的重要问题。
比特币钱包的基本概念
比特币钱包是一种存储、管理比特币的工具。它并不真正存储比特币,而是存储用户的私钥和公钥,这些钥匙用于管理比特币的所有权和进行交易功能。用户通过钱包的公钥进行接收比特币,通过私钥进行交易签名,确保资金的转移合法有效。
比特币钱包的安全性因素
比特币钱包的安全架构涉及多个方面,以下是一些关键安全因素:
1. 私钥的安全性
私钥是比特币钱包的核心,它掌控着用户的数字资产。确保私钥不被泄露是保障比特币钱包安全的首要任务。用户应当将私钥存储在安全的地方,例如冷钱包或硬件钱包。冷钱包是指完全离线的安全设备,而硬件钱包如Ledger或Trezor等则可以在离线状态下进行安全交易。
2. 公钥和地址的生成
公钥及所生成的比特币地址是接收比特币的关键,确保其生成过程的随机性和安全性十分重要。生成公钥的过程应使用高质量的随机数生成算法,以防他人预测或攻击。
3. 钱包类型的选择
比特币钱包主要有热钱包和冷钱包两种类型。热钱包直接连接互联网,使用方便但相对安全性较差,适合日常小额交易;冷钱包则以离线方式存储资金,安全性高,适合长期保存大额资产。
钱包架构的设计原则
在设计比特币钱包的安全架构时,应遵循以下原则:
1. 透明性与可审计性
一个安全的钱包架构应当允许用户随时进行审计,确保资金和私钥的安全。开源代码可以增加透明性,并允许社区的开发者进行审查和安全性检查。
2. 多重签名机制
多重签名机制确保交易的多方验证,增强了钱包的安全性。用户可设置多个密钥同时授权一笔交易,避免单一私钥被盗取而导致全面损失。
3. 定期更新与安全审计
定期更新钱包软件和系统,可以修复潜在的安全漏洞。定期进行第三方安全审计,可以及时发现并解决存在的安全隐患。
常见的比特币钱包安全问题
尽管比特币钱包的安全架构已经相对成熟,许多仍存在显著安全隐患。
1. 钓鱼攻击
使用钓鱼手段窃取用户的私钥是黑客常用的伎俩。用户应对任何请求私钥的行为保持警惕,确保只在可信的平台进行操作。
2. 跨平台安全性问题
比特币钱包经常在不同平台之间运作,跨平台安全性很重要。若某一平台出现安全漏洞,则可能导致其他平台的安全问题。用户要使用信誉良好的平台和软件。
3. 社会工程学攻击
黑客可能利用社会工程学手段欺骗用户提供私钥或敏感信息。用户应提高警惕,保护自身信息安全。
可能相关的问题
如何选择安全的比特币钱包?
选择一个安全的比特币钱包对保障资金安全至关重要。首先,用户应根据下列几方面来做出选择:
- 钱包类型:热钱包适合频繁小额交易,冷钱包适合长期大额存储。
- 开发者声誉:选择那些由专业团队开发、拥有良好口碑的钱包。
- 二次验证功能:多重签名或两步验证可以增加安全性,在资金发生变化时能增加保障。
在选择时,可以参考网评以及用户反馈,并关注钱包的更新和维护记录。
如何避免比特币钱包被黑客攻击?
黑客攻击通常是资金损失的主要原因。避免钱包被攻击的措施包括:
- 定期更改密码:对支付密码和私钥进行定期更改,增强安全性。
- 使用硬件钱包:为了最大限度地保护资产,尽量选择硬件钱包进行存储。
- 启用通知:启用钱包的滥用通知,确保在任何异常活动时获得及时提醒。
综合运用多种方法,将使钱包受到黑客攻击的几率大大降低。
比特币钱包私钥丢失后如何恢复?
如果用户丢失了钱包的私钥,实际上对应的比特币也随之无法恢复。应及时采取措施以尽量降低损失:
- 确保备份:使用多个备份方式进行私钥备份,包括物理和电子备份。
- 寻求专业帮助:在极端情况下,可以寻求专业服务帮助恢复资产,但成功率并不保证。
- 注意信息保护:一旦任何数据泄露,需第一时间采取措施保护剩余资产。
综上所述,安全的钱包架构是保护数字资产的基石。通过对安全问题的深入了解,用户可以更好地保护自己的比特币和其他数字资产。